Juliana de Lima Vasconcellos is one stylish woman. Her beautiful houses, architectual projects and beautifully designed funiture are unique and equally stylish as herself. No wonder she is seen as the most prominent interior architect of her generation in Brazil.

 

Throughout her years working within fashion, architecture and design, Juliana has lived in cities like New York, Barcelona and London and now divides her time between her houses in Rio de Janeiro and Belo Horizonte, Brazil.

Juliana is the founder of the Vasconcellos Studio and co-founder of Vasconcellos Barreto, where she develops furniture and decoration pieces along with the architect Matheus Barreto.

 

" I love real materials like stone and wood and adore fabrics with a lot of texture. Helping my clients buying art and collective design give me great pleasure. I have a major passion for modern furniture, especially French, Brazilian and Scandinavian. My favorites designers are Mattia Bonetti, Maria Pergay, Jean Royere, Joaquin Tenreiro, Paul Evans and Rick Owens. I addition, I really like ceramics, particularly German.

What design trends do you see?

 

- Organic shapes, natural textures, special glass, desaturated colors, prints and handmade technics.

Juliana's pedigree of work and awards are impressive with many exciting collaborations and projects in pipeline. Her work has been published in most magazines and important publications and in addition, she has taken part of the most important and luxurious showcase for interior design in Brazil, the Mostra Black.

 

Her portfolio also includes furniture exposé in IDA/ARTRIO and MADE. As mentioned above, Juliana also develops and designs furniture pieces and recent collaborations includes eg: several galleries that participates of PAD Paris, PAD London, SParte and ArtRio.
